§ 23-3-510. Costs and expenses of proceedings — Damages
The Arkansas Public Service Commission shall require the applicant to pay all costs and expenses of a proceeding under this subchapter.
§ 23-3-511. Review by circuit court
(a) Any party to a proceeding conducted pursuant to this subchapter before the Arkansas Public Service Commission, within twenty (20) days after a final order is made, may file a petition with the Pulaski County Circuit Court against the commission for the purpose of having the lawfulness of its final decision inquired into and determined. § 23-3-512. Appeal to Supreme Court
(a) The Arkansas Public Service Commission, the river crossing proprietor, or any other party to an action in the circuit court to review the order of the commission, within thirty (30) days after the entry of the final judgment of the circuit court, may appeal to the Supreme Court. § 23-3-603. Grant of certificate generally
(a) The Arkansas Public Service Commission shall grant a certificate if it finds that the proposed extension project is of economic benefit to the gas utility and its existing ratepayers and is in the public interest. § 23-3-503. Commission’s jurisdiction, power, and authority
(a) The Arkansas Public Service Commission shall have jurisdiction over all navigable water crossings.
